The error message "ErrCode=1 SubCode=18" in IBM SPSS Statistics 29 typically indicates that
The good news? This isn't a "broken" software issue; it’s almost always a communication breakdown between your computer and the license file. Here is how to fix it. What Does "Subcode 18" Actually Mean? The error message "ErrCode=1 SubCode=18" in IBM SPSS
spssutil -showlic.The lservrc file is the source of the subcode 18 error. Deleting it forces SPSS to forget the broken hash. Diagnose with spssutil -showlic
Check host identifiers:
If you previously used the Subscription version (logged in with an IBM ID) and are now trying to use a Site License (using a 20-character code), the two versions can conflict. Phase 2: Delete the Corrupt License File (The
To fix this effectively, you have to move beyond just re-entering the code. You need to reset the licensing environment. 1. The "Clean Slate" Method (Most Effective)
Before digging into system files, try the official route. Sometimes the initial activation doesn't "stick." Close SPSS completely.